ObjectivesThe main objective was to collect cores and 3.5kHz profiles from a number of sediment drifts on the continental rise. This area is the focus of international collaboration in the form of a) the SEDANO programme of the Osservatorio Geofisico Sperimentale (OGS); b) Ocean Drilling Program (ODP). Secondary objectives included comparison of ship-mounted and towed magnetometers, and plankton sampling from surface water.
